Summary: | PROBLEM TO BE SOLVED: To provide a method for reducing molecular weight of an organic material capable of providing a modified article with high quality and high calory by effectively reducing molecular weight of the organic material, capable of stable operation without generating obstruction trouble or gas leakage in a supply system of the organic material without reduction of calorie of a product gas and reduction of gas yield.SOLUTION: There is provided a method for reducing molecular weight by contacting a mixed gas (g) obtained by a shift reaction of carbon monoxide-containing gas (g) and steam with an organic material in a reactor for reducing molecular weight 2 and modifying the organic material, where a part of the mixed gas (g) is used as a carrier gas or a seal gas of a fixed amount charging device when the organic material molded to granular is charged into the reactor for reducing molecular weight 2 by blowing the carrier gas or dropping charging from the fixed amount charging device.SELECTED DRAWING: Figure 1
